    The disruption of the first day has a knock on effect, which builds. You can expect to see this disruption increasing for a few weeks I would imagine. There are strict rules about turn around times for crew and the amount of time they have to have off between flights for health and safety reasons. If flights are delayed, it bumps all the schedules around, especially for airlines which are operating well below the required flight crew levels. I shall name no names!

    One very well known airline is apparently operating 300 pilots below the required level. Can't reveal my sources but he may well be a pilot - I hear that they are arriving at the gate after landing, to find a mangaer waiting for them on the tarmac, to tell them they will be flying again in 12 hours. They have to have 2 days off in 12, which means that many of them will be abroad when their rest days are due, so the airline has to find another pilot to send out there to fly the plane back. It is exacerbating the current problem.
